Committee functions: (1) to receive, sort & prepare the records of GLA, specifically Division, Interest Group & Committee files, (2) to keep copies of conference programs; the Georgia Library Quarterly; Executive Board minutes; Treasurer's records; and other official records of the Association, and (3) to forward all records to the archives housed at Valdosta State University.
Members: a Chair (the GLA Archivist), the Secretary of the Executive Board, plus one other member appointed by the Chair.
